Mumbai (Commonwealth Union)_ Pushpa 2: The Rule has cemented its place as a monumental success in Indian cinema, with its lifetime box office collections continuing to defy expectations. Over the course of 47 days, the film has amassed an impressive ₹1228.9 crore (India net) and ₹1464.9 crore in gross collections, solidifying its status as one of the biggest blockbusters in recent years. The film’s journey at the box office began with massive numbers, as packed theatres and record-breaking collections across the country marked its early days. However, as with any film that enjoys a long run, the numbers have begun to dip gradually, especially during weekdays.

On its 47th day, the film brought in ₹0.65 crore (India net) across all languages, a significant drop from its earlier high collections. While weekends still see a slight boost with ₹1.1 crore on Saturday and ₹1.5 crore on Sunday, weekday earnings, such as Monday’s ₹65 lakh, suggest that the film’s theatrical run is nearing its conclusion. Despite the gradual decline in collections, Pushpa 2 has proven to be a box office juggernaut, due to its impressive multi-language reach. The Telugu version has been the backbone of the film’s earnings, contributing ₹339.61 crore to the overall net total. This strong performance is unsurprising, given the home-state advantage in Andhra Pradesh and Telangana, where the film grossed ₹328.85 crore in these two regions alone.

The Hindi version, however, has been the real game-changer for the film. With ₹808.81 crore contributing to the net collection, it has proven that the Pushpa franchise has evolved into a pan-Indian phenomenon, with Allu Arjun’s star power breaking linguistic and regional barriers. This remarkable achievement underscores the growing popularity of regional cinema in Hindi-speaking markets. Additionally, Pushpa 2 also found its audience in Tamil Nadu, where the Tamil-dubbed version of the film earned ₹58.6 crore. Despite stiff competition from local releases, the film managed to generate ₹77.25 crore net in Tamil Nadu, making it a significant accomplishment for a dubbed Telugu film in the region.

In Kerala, the Malayalam version of the movie earned ₹14.15 crore, contributing to an overall Kerala total of ₹18.1 crore net. While the figures were not as high as in other regions, it still highlighted Allu Arjun’s solid fan base in the state. The Kannada version, meanwhile, garnered ₹7.77 crore, and Karnataka, while falling short of the ₹100-crore mark, brought in a respectable ₹98.22 crore net. When looking at the regional breakdown of collections, the movie has performed exceptionally well across various parts of India. Andhra Pradesh and Telangana lead the way with ₹328.85 crore, followed by the Hindi market with a staggering ₹808.81 crore. Tamil Nadu has contributed ₹77.25 crore, Kerala ₹18.1 crore, and Karnataka ₹98.22 crore, with the rest of India, driven largely by Hindi audiences, accounting for ₹942.48 crore.
The film’s recent reloaded version, released on January 17 with 20 extra minutes, did provide a temporary surge in interest, but it wasn’t enough to reignite its box office momentum significantly.
